bubieyehyeh said:veryintrigued said:bubieyehyeh said:While the letter is carefully worded I believe you can close the account early, based on the saving terms and conditions section 7.8
https://www.thenottingham.com/~/media/files/savings/forms and documents/savings-terms-march-19-lit3117.pdf?la=enIf we materially decrease an interest rate to your disadvantage, we will notify you in writing 14 days in advance of the change.You will be given 30 days from the date of this notification to close or switch your account without notice or penalty.We will define a decrease to an interest rate as ‘material’ if it reduces more than the Bank of England Base RateSo I've emailed to ask if my assumption is correct, and if so what the early closure process is. .
Any response from NBS please @bubieyehyeh
I received a response by email yesterday from the query I sent them on Monday. Their response states:-
"We are aware that there was a mistake in the letters that were sent out regarding these accounts, however as this was our error, you can now close your account prior to the maturity date without occurring [sic] any penalties"
I shall be visiting my nearest branch on 1st November to close them. As well as the Virgin RS19 (store version)I consider myself to be a male feminist. Is that allowed?1 -

Cambridge RS maturity
The ability to set my maturity instructions have appeared online.
The default was an easy access but their system had kept my external current account details.
Its also possible to open a 3% Loyalty RS with the maturity funds (I suspect most, like me, will already have this).
I'll revisit the maturity instructions after November's payment to see if anything has changed, assuming it doesn't get bounced back, as I only performed a dummy run.1 -
